Individualized therapy sessions are available for children, youth, and adults. They offer 50 and 80-minute sessions to provide counselling on various issues, such as stress, anxiety, depression, divorce, and eating disorders.

Meanwhile, the couples therapy sessions, lasting for 50 minutes or 80 minutes, are designed for all stages of relationships. With these therapy sessions couples are able to develop greater connectedness while learning the skills to better communicate with each other. The goal is to have happy, resilient and healthy relationships.

The family therapy sessions provide family members the opportunity to eliminate the division that has existed between them and reconnect. These are also available in 50 and 80-minutes sessions.

The areas of practice of Meredith MacKenzie include anxiety disorders, eating disorders, depression and mood disorders, divorce/separation, life transitions/adjustments, parenting education, couples counselling, emotional dysregulation, and family difficulties. She uses various approaches including attachment-based therapy, mindfulness-based cognitive therapy, dialectical behavioural therapy, mindfulness approaches, emotionally-focused therapy, Gottman method for couples, and FBT for childhood eating disorders.

Meanwhile, Christine Skwarok is also a registered clinical counsellor and serves as clinical traumatologist. Her areas of practice include anxiety disorders, stress management, trauma, depression and mood disorders, families of special needs children, goal setting and motivation, life transitions, and relationship issues. Her approaches include acceptance and commitment therapy (ACT), mindfulness-based cognitive therapy, solution-focused brief therapy, tri-phasic model of trauma, motivational interviewing, resiliency training, Gottman method, and The Incredible Years parenting program.

Sarah Boyle is also a registered counsellor and her areas of practice include eating disorders, anxiety disorders, depression and mood disorders, life transitions/adjustments, grief, emotional dysregulation, couples counselling, adolescent and adult counselling, and life skills training. Her approaches include attachment-based therapy, mindfulness-based cognitive therapy, dialectical behavioural therapy, solution-focused therapy, emotionally-focused therapy, acceptance therapy, mindfulness and somatic therapy, and self-compassion therapy.

Ashley Greensmyth is another registered clinical counsellor. Her areas of practice include anxiety disorders, depression and mood disorders, identity exploration, relationship issues, couple counselling, life transitions, and goal setting and motivation. Her approaches include Adlerian therapy, nonviolent communication, mindfulness-based cognitive therapy, mindfulness approaches, Gottman method, and emotion-focused therapy.
